Starrett Outside Micrometers

Each micrometer thimble has a constant-force mechanism, so that once the spindle contacts the surface of the measured object, it will stop tightening. This ensures repeatable measurements and prevents over-tightening.
Friction thimbles continue to turn with resistance when the micrometer’s spindle stops tightening.
230 and 232 series have decimal equivalents stamped on the frame.
